WebTraditional breakfast foods in Canada are cooked eggs, fried pork sausages or bacon, fried or deep-fried potatoes, toasted bread, pancakes (or egg-battered French Toast) and syrup, cereals, or hot oatmeal. Hodge-podge is a rich, hearty stew that originated in Nova Scotia, CanadaThe soup’s name is typically extracted from the English term hotch-potch, meaning mixing, referring to the stew’s preparation using a variety of vegetables like potatoes, beans, and carrots.

Maple syrup is made from xylem sap of maple trees. 71% of maple syrup is produced in Canada. It is easily Canada’s most iconic food, and one of the best-known stereotypes of the country.
